aws-cloudformation / aws-cloudformation-resource-providers-memorydb
File Size

The distribution of size of files (measured in lines of code).

Intro
  • File size measurements show the distribution of size of files.
  • Files are classified in four categories based on their size (lines of code): 1-100 (very small files), 101-200 (small files), 201-500 (medium size files), 501-1000 (long files), 1001+(very long files).
  • It is a good practice to keep files small. Long files may become "bloaters", code that have increased to such gargantuan proportions that they are hard to work with.
Learn more...
File Size Overall
  • There are 62 files with 3,386 lines of code.
    • 0 very long files (0 lines of code)
    • 0 long files (0 lines of code)
    • 1 medium size files (213 lines of codeclsfd_ftr_w_mp_ins)
    • 13 small files (1,861 lines of code)
    • 48 very small files (1,312 lines of code)
0% | 0% | 6% | 54% | 38%
Legend:
1001+
501-1000
201-500
101-200
1-100


explore: zoomable circles | sunburst | 3D view
File Size per Extension
1001+
501-1000
201-500
101-200
1-100
java0% | 0% | 6% | 59% | 33%
yaml0% | 0% | 0% | 0% | 100%
yml0% | 0% | 0% | 0% | 100%
File Size per Logical Decomposition
primary
1001+
501-1000
201-500
101-200
1-100
aws-memorydb-cluster/src0% | 0% | 28% | 47% | 24%
aws-memorydb-parametergroup/src0% | 0% | 0% | 75% | 24%
aws-memorydb-subnetgroup/src0% | 0% | 0% | 68% | 31%
aws-memorydb-acl/src0% | 0% | 0% | 62% | 37%
aws-memorydb-user/src0% | 0% | 0% | 47% | 52%
aws-memorydb-parametergroup0% | 0% | 0% | 0% | 100%
aws-memorydb-acl0% | 0% | 0% | 0% | 100%
aws-memorydb-cluster0% | 0% | 0% | 0% | 100%
aws-memorydb-user0% | 0% | 0% | 0% | 100%
aws-memorydb-subnetgroup0% | 0% | 0% | 0% | 100%
Longest Files (Top 50)
File# lines# units
Translator.java
in aws-memorydb-cluster/src/main/java/software/amazon/memorydb/cluster
213 22
UpdateHandler.java
in aws-memorydb-parametergroup/src/main/java/software/amazon/memorydb/parametergroup
197 9
UpdateHandler.java
in aws-memorydb-cluster/src/main/java/software/amazon/memorydb/cluster
196 8
UpdateHandler.java
in aws-memorydb-acl/src/main/java/software/amazon/memorydb/acl
161 7
BaseHandlerStd.java
in aws-memorydb-cluster/src/main/java/software/amazon/memorydb/cluster
157 9
BaseHandlerStd.java
in aws-memorydb-subnetgroup/src/main/java/software/amazon/memorydb/subnetgroup
151 8
Translator.java
in aws-memorydb-subnetgroup/src/main/java/software/amazon/memorydb/subnetgroup
136 19
Translator.java
in aws-memorydb-parametergroup/src/main/java/software/amazon/memorydb/parametergroup
135 21
Translator.java
in aws-memorydb-user/src/main/java/software/amazon/memorydb/user
131 15
BaseHandlerStd.java
in aws-memorydb-parametergroup/src/main/java/software/amazon/memorydb/parametergroup
130 6
UpdateHandler.java
in aws-memorydb-subnetgroup/src/main/java/software/amazon/memorydb/subnetgroup
127 8
UpdateHandler.java
in aws-memorydb-user/src/main/java/software/amazon/memorydb/user
122 7
Translator.java
in aws-memorydb-acl/src/main/java/software/amazon/memorydb/acl
117 15
BaseHandlerStd.java
in aws-memorydb-acl/src/main/java/software/amazon/memorydb/acl
101 4
BaseHandlerStd.java
in aws-memorydb-user/src/main/java/software/amazon/memorydb/user
81 3
DeleteHandler.java
in aws-memorydb-acl/src/main/java/software/amazon/memorydb/acl
79 4
DeleteHandler.java
in aws-memorydb-subnetgroup/src/main/java/software/amazon/memorydb/subnetgroup
57 3
DeleteHandler.java
in aws-memorydb-user/src/main/java/software/amazon/memorydb/user
53 2
ReadHandler.java
in aws-memorydb-user/src/main/java/software/amazon/memorydb/user
52 3
ReadHandler.java
in aws-memorydb-acl/src/main/java/software/amazon/memorydb/acl
52 3
CreateHandler.java
in aws-memorydb-cluster/src/main/java/software/amazon/memorydb/cluster
48 2
CreateHandler.java
in aws-memorydb-subnetgroup/src/main/java/software/amazon/memorydb/subnetgroup
48 2
CreateHandler.java
in aws-memorydb-parametergroup/src/main/java/software/amazon/memorydb/parametergroup
46 2
DeleteHandler.java
in aws-memorydb-cluster/src/main/java/software/amazon/memorydb/cluster
43 3
resource-role.yaml
in aws-memorydb-parametergroup
38 -
CreateHandler.java
in aws-memorydb-acl/src/main/java/software/amazon/memorydb/acl
38 1
resource-role.yaml
in aws-memorydb-acl
37 -
resource-role.yaml
in aws-memorydb-cluster
36 -
CreateHandler.java
in aws-memorydb-user/src/main/java/software/amazon/memorydb/user
36 1
resource-role.yaml
in aws-memorydb-user
36 -
resource-role.yaml
in aws-memorydb-subnetgroup
36 -
ListHandler.java
in aws-memorydb-user/src/main/java/software/amazon/memorydb/user
27 1
ListHandler.java
in aws-memorydb-acl/src/main/java/software/amazon/memorydb/acl
27 1
DeleteHandler.java
in aws-memorydb-parametergroup/src/main/java/software/amazon/memorydb/parametergroup
26 1
ReadHandler.java
in aws-memorydb-subnetgroup/src/main/java/software/amazon/memorydb/subnetgroup
24 1
ReadHandler.java
in aws-memorydb-parametergroup/src/main/java/software/amazon/memorydb/parametergroup
23 1
ListHandler.java
in aws-memorydb-subnetgroup/src/main/java/software/amazon/memorydb/subnetgroup
23 1
ListHandler.java
in aws-memorydb-cluster/src/main/java/software/amazon/memorydb/cluster
21 1
template.yml
in aws-memorydb-cluster
20 -
template.yml
in aws-memorydb-user
20 -
template.yml
in aws-memorydb-parametergroup
20 -
template.yml
in aws-memorydb-acl
20 -
template.yml
in aws-memorydb-subnetgroup
20 -
ReadHandler.java
in aws-memorydb-cluster/src/main/java/software/amazon/memorydb/cluster
19 1
ListHandler.java
in aws-memorydb-parametergroup/src/main/java/software/amazon/memorydb/parametergroup
18 1
Configuration.java
in aws-memorydb-cluster/src/main/java/software/amazon/memorydb/cluster
17 2
Configuration.java
in aws-memorydb-user/src/main/java/software/amazon/memorydb/user
17 2
Configuration.java
in aws-memorydb-parametergroup/src/main/java/software/amazon/memorydb/parametergroup
17 2
Configuration.java
in aws-memorydb-acl/src/main/java/software/amazon/memorydb/acl
17 2
Configuration.java
in aws-memorydb-subnetgroup/src/main/java/software/amazon/memorydb/subnetgroup
17 2
Files With Most Units (Top 20)
File# lines# units
Translator.java
in aws-memorydb-cluster/src/main/java/software/amazon/memorydb/cluster
213 22
Translator.java
in aws-memorydb-parametergroup/src/main/java/software/amazon/memorydb/parametergroup
135 21
Translator.java
in aws-memorydb-subnetgroup/src/main/java/software/amazon/memorydb/subnetgroup
136 19
Translator.java
in aws-memorydb-user/src/main/java/software/amazon/memorydb/user
131 15
Translator.java
in aws-memorydb-acl/src/main/java/software/amazon/memorydb/acl
117 15
BaseHandlerStd.java
in aws-memorydb-cluster/src/main/java/software/amazon/memorydb/cluster
157 9
UpdateHandler.java
in aws-memorydb-parametergroup/src/main/java/software/amazon/memorydb/parametergroup
197 9
UpdateHandler.java
in aws-memorydb-cluster/src/main/java/software/amazon/memorydb/cluster
196 8
BaseHandlerStd.java
in aws-memorydb-subnetgroup/src/main/java/software/amazon/memorydb/subnetgroup
151 8
UpdateHandler.java
in aws-memorydb-subnetgroup/src/main/java/software/amazon/memorydb/subnetgroup
127 8
UpdateHandler.java
in aws-memorydb-user/src/main/java/software/amazon/memorydb/user
122 7
UpdateHandler.java
in aws-memorydb-acl/src/main/java/software/amazon/memorydb/acl
161 7
BaseHandlerStd.java
in aws-memorydb-parametergroup/src/main/java/software/amazon/memorydb/parametergroup
130 6
DeleteHandler.java
in aws-memorydb-acl/src/main/java/software/amazon/memorydb/acl
79 4
BaseHandlerStd.java
in aws-memorydb-acl/src/main/java/software/amazon/memorydb/acl
101 4
DeleteHandler.java
in aws-memorydb-cluster/src/main/java/software/amazon/memorydb/cluster
43 3
BaseHandlerStd.java
in aws-memorydb-user/src/main/java/software/amazon/memorydb/user
81 3
ReadHandler.java
in aws-memorydb-user/src/main/java/software/amazon/memorydb/user
52 3
ReadHandler.java
in aws-memorydb-acl/src/main/java/software/amazon/memorydb/acl
52 3
DeleteHandler.java
in aws-memorydb-subnetgroup/src/main/java/software/amazon/memorydb/subnetgroup
57 3
Files With Long Lines (Top 20)

There are 25 files with lines longer than 120 characters. In total, there are 189 long lines.

File# lines# units# long lines
UpdateHandler.java
in aws-memorydb-cluster/src/main/java/software/amazon/memorydb/cluster
196 8 37
UpdateHandler.java
in aws-memorydb-parametergroup/src/main/java/software/amazon/memorydb/parametergroup
197 9 21
BaseHandlerStd.java
in aws-memorydb-cluster/src/main/java/software/amazon/memorydb/cluster
157 9 19
BaseHandlerStd.java
in aws-memorydb-subnetgroup/src/main/java/software/amazon/memorydb/subnetgroup
151 8 15
UpdateHandler.java
in aws-memorydb-subnetgroup/src/main/java/software/amazon/memorydb/subnetgroup
127 8 14
Translator.java
in aws-memorydb-cluster/src/main/java/software/amazon/memorydb/cluster
213 22 10
Translator.java
in aws-memorydb-parametergroup/src/main/java/software/amazon/memorydb/parametergroup
135 21 8
Translator.java
in aws-memorydb-subnetgroup/src/main/java/software/amazon/memorydb/subnetgroup
136 19 7
CreateHandler.java
in aws-memorydb-cluster/src/main/java/software/amazon/memorydb/cluster
48 2 6
CreateHandler.java
in aws-memorydb-parametergroup/src/main/java/software/amazon/memorydb/parametergroup
46 2 6
DeleteHandler.java
in aws-memorydb-subnetgroup/src/main/java/software/amazon/memorydb/subnetgroup
57 3 6
DeleteHandler.java
in aws-memorydb-cluster/src/main/java/software/amazon/memorydb/cluster
43 3 5
BaseHandlerStd.java
in aws-memorydb-parametergroup/src/main/java/software/amazon/memorydb/parametergroup
130 6 5
CreateHandler.java
in aws-memorydb-subnetgroup/src/main/java/software/amazon/memorydb/subnetgroup
48 2 5
ListHandler.java
in aws-memorydb-cluster/src/main/java/software/amazon/memorydb/cluster
21 1 4
DeleteHandler.java
in aws-memorydb-parametergroup/src/main/java/software/amazon/memorydb/parametergroup
26 1 4
ListHandler.java
in aws-memorydb-parametergroup/src/main/java/software/amazon/memorydb/parametergroup
18 1 3
Translator.java
in aws-memorydb-acl/src/main/java/software/amazon/memorydb/acl
117 15 3
Translator.java
in aws-memorydb-user/src/main/java/software/amazon/memorydb/user
131 15 2
ReadHandler.java
in aws-memorydb-user/src/main/java/software/amazon/memorydb/user
52 3 2